PM: Tanzania has scarcity of 1.4 million desks for primary schools
Prime Minister Mizengo Pinda said yesterday that Primary Schools the country were facing a shortage of about 1.4 desks, directing the education ministry to do whatever it can to address the problem that affects academic performance of students.
